[FIX] mrp: Use the route on the production if set to create the previous moves
Description of the issue/feature this PR addresses: The production routing is ignored when creating previous movements Current behavior before PR: When you create a production that does not have a routing established in the BOM, and you set a route manually, it is ignored when creating the previous movements
